Joe’s Crab Shack Crab Dip


  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ened

  • 1/2 cup sour cream

  • 1/4 cup mayonnaise

  • 1 cup lump crab meat (fresh or pasteurized)

  • 1/2 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ese

  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ese

  • 1/4 cup green onions, finely chopped

  • 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ce

  • 1 tsp Old Bay seasoning

  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der

  • 1/2 tsp onion powder

  • Salt and pepper, to taste

Optional substitutions:

  • Greek yogurt instead of sour cream

  • Neufchâtel instead of cream cheese

  • Hot sauce for heat

  • Smoked paprika for depth


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).

  • In a large bowl, mix cream cheese, sour cream, and mayo until smooth.

  • Add seasonings, Worcestershire sauce, and fold in lump crab meat gently.

  • Stir in cheeses and green onions. Reserve some cheese for topping.

  • Spread mixture into a baking dish and top with remaining cheese.

  • Bake for 20 minutes or until golden and bubbly.

 

  • Let cool 5 minutes before serving. Garnish with extra green onions if desired.

Notes

  • Best served warm in a skillet or ceramic dish.

  • Avoid overmixing crab to preserve texture.

  • Not ideal for freezing due to dairy content.

 

  • Reheat leftovers at 325°F for 10–15 minutes.
